I'm trying to run the 32bit version of Groupwise. So far I can install it
without any major hickups but when I actually start to run the Grpwise.exe
it will prompt me to login to the groupwise mail server but bombs out with
a debug xterm. It appears to be able to connect to the groupwise server ok
for verifying the password. If I put in a bogus one it will tell me I have
used the wrong password. What sort of debuging information should I look
for and how can I obtain debug info? If I use --debugmsg +relay it put out
a hug amount of stuff. I would like to learn how to troubleshoot these sort
of things so that I can start working on getting several of our winblows
applications (here at work) running on linux.
Here's a break down of what I have.
Redhat 7.2
Wine release 20011004 & the Wine-Devel via RPM
A full Windows 98 second edition install located under /usr/share/wine-c (I
pulled all of this from a ghost image).
